BOMBA- an animation

Check out the animation for this dance form known as BOMBA. This style of dance & music is from the island of Puerto Rico. The dancer uses her skirt as an instrument to challenge the drummers rythmn.

Inspiration


Mixplay is the name of this project by Uniqlo. The interface is designed to "Mix your own dance and soundmix" The dancers are a group called Umin.
http://www.uniqlo.jp/mixplay/


I appreciate how each dancer embodies the sound.The dance style is a street dance form known as Pop'n (or poppin) en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Poppin I also love the colors and the white background. This interface is a great way to have users create their own sound mixes.

My overall goal for this class is to create an interactive visual media installation that involves users creating the sound mix with their own body movement.
